Hidden head lock fixing structure
By pre-embedding the hanging parts and cover inside the helmet shell, combined with the hook and buckle structure of the head lock hanging parts, the problem of fixing the helmet head lock under special shape or mold restriction is solved, realizing fast and stable installation, expanding the scope of application and optimizing the user experience.

TECHNICAL FIELD
[0001] The utility model relates to a safety helmet technical field especially relates to a hidden head lock fixing structure. BACKGROUND
[0002] With the development of economy, people's daily life is more and more colorful, and cycling becomes a kind of sport, green travel way, and the necessary tool in the cycling process is safety helmet, and safety helmet can effectively protect the safety of users.
[0003] The current safety helmet head lock fixing structure is single, and cannot be fixed by using the conventional base or pendant under the restriction of some special shapes or molds, and there is no head lock fixing structure for this situation, and higher production demand cannot be met, so it is necessary to improve. INVENTION CONTENTS
[0004] The utility model provides a kind of optimization product structure, head lock structure can be fixed on helmet quickly and stably under the restriction of special helmet shape or mold, widely applicable, can satisfy higher use demand of user, optimize user experience, it is a kind of hidden head lock fixing structure that installation is convenient and fast;The technical problem that the single head lock fixing structure of current safety helmet exists in prior art is solved, cannot be fixed by using the conventional base or pendant under the restriction of some special shapes or molds, higher production demand cannot be met.
[0005] The above technical problems of the utility model are solved by the following technical scheme: a kind of hidden head lock fixing structure, including the EPS fixed in helmet shell, the EPS is embedded with several embedded components, embedded component includes cover and pendant embedded part, EPS is equipped with head lock pendant corresponding with embedded component, head lock pendant is equipped with wing and head lock component on it.The pendant embedded part and cover of the utility model are assembled and foamed and embedded into EPS, the cover is used to protect and isolate, ensure that there is no EPS in the internal assembly area when foaming, then fixed by inserting the both ends of head lock pendant into pendant embedded part, then install wing to the sliding slot of head lock pendant, head lock component is connected and assembled with wing, finally, it can be assembled with fabric belt, the head lock fixing structure of the utility model can be used in the situation that cannot be fixed by using the conventional base or pendant under the restriction of some shapes or molds, it is assembled by multiple small components, and embedded smaller, can meet the production needs of mold.
[0006] As preferred, the pendant embedded part is composed of hollow skeleton extending to the four sides of EPS and slot structure.The pendant embedded part of the utility model is composed of skeleton structure extending to the inside horizontally and longitudinally and slot structure, and the sheet skeleton structure of pendant embedded part is used to embed and fix in EPS, and the slot structure is used to connect and fix with head lock component.
[0007] As preferred, the cover is buckled on the bottom of the hanging piece pre-embedded part, and the cover and the hanging piece pre-embedded part are assembled together and then pre-embedded in EPS, the cover plays a protective and isolating role, ensures that there is no EPS in the internal assembly area during foaming, and ensures that the headlock hanging piece can be inserted into the hanging piece pre-embedded part.
[0008] As preferred, the headlock hanging piece is inserted into the hanging piece pre-embedded part through the hook foot plug buckle structure and is fixed. The headlock hanging piece is connected and fixed through the plug-in structure, and the hook foot plug buckle structure at both ends of the headlock hanging piece is inserted into the slot structure of the hanging piece pre-embedded part and is fixed, then the wing is installed on the sliding groove of the headlock hanging piece, the headlock assembly is connected and assembled with the wing, and finally the fabric belt can be assembled.
[0009] As preferred, a plurality of fabric belt grooves are formed on the headlock hanging piece, and inclined grooves which are communicated with the fabric belt grooves are formed on the main body of the headlock hanging piece. When the fabric belt is assembled, the inclined grooves on both sides of the headlock hanging piece can be directly sleeved into the fabric belt grooves, so that the assembly is convenient and fast, and the fabric belt is not worried about falling off, and the fabric belt does not need to be threaded through each component.
[0010] As preferred, the wing is connected with the headlock hanging piece through the sliding groove structure. The wing and the headlock assembly in the utility model are the conventional structure of the safety helmet at present, the connection and cooperation of the wing and the headlock hanging piece are also the conventional connection structure, and the wing is connected and fixed through the sliding groove structure.
[0011] Therefore, the hidden headlock fixing structure has the following advantages: the product structure is optimized, the headlock structure can be quickly and stably fixed on the helmet under the limitation of special helmet shape or mold, the application range is wide, higher use demand of users can be met, user experience is optimized, and installation is convenient and fast. [0020] Example:
[0021] As Figure 1 and 2 and 3 and 4 and 5 and 6, a hidden head lock fixing structure, including EPS1 fixed in the inside of the helmet shell, two pre-embedded assemblies are pre-embedded in the inside of EPS1, the pre-embedded assembly includes the hanging piece embedded part 2 in the inner layer and the cover body 3 in the outer layer, the cover body 3 is buckled on the bottom of the hanging piece embedded part 2, and the hanging piece embedded part 2 is prevented from entering the foamed plastic.
[0022] The hanging piece embedded part 2 is composed of the hollow skeleton 4 extending from the four sides of EPS1 and the slot structure, and the hollow skeleton 4 of the hanging piece embedded part 2 includes the skeleton structure extending horizontally and longitudinally.
[0023] The head lock hanging piece 10 is installed in EPS1 and is fixed by plug-in connection with the pre-embedded assembly, and the head lock hanging piece 10 is inserted into the slot 5 of the hanging piece embedded part 2 through the hook foot plug-in buckle structure at both ends.
[0024] The head lock hanging piece 10 is installed with the wing 6 and the head lock assembly 7, the wing 6 is connected and installed with the head lock hanging piece 10 through the sliding groove structure, two braid grooves 8 are formed in the head lock hanging piece 10, and two inclined grooves 9 are formed in the two sides of the main body of the head lock hanging piece 10 and are communicated with the braid grooves 8.
[0025] The hanging piece embedded part 2 and the cover body 3 in the utility model are assembled and foamed and pre-embedded into EPS1, the cover body 3 plays a protection and isolation role, ensures that there is no EPS1 in the internal assembly area during foaming, then the hook foot plug-in buckle structure at both ends of the head lock hanging piece 10 is inserted into the slot structure of the hanging piece embedded part 2 for fixation, the wing 6 is installed on the sliding groove of the head lock hanging piece 10, the head lock assembly 7 is connected and assembled with the wing 6, and finally the braid can be assembled.
[0026] When the braid is assembled, the inclined grooves 9 at both sides of the head lock hanging piece 10 can be directly sleeved into the braid grooves 8, so that the assembly is convenient and fast and the braid is not worried about falling off.
[0027] The head lock fixing structure can be suitable for the case that the conventional base or hanging piece cannot be used for fixing due to the limitation of some shapes or molds, is assembled by multiple small parts, and is pre-buried smaller, and can meet the production needs of mold stripping.
